Get started11 Marley Gardens is a two-bedroom semi-detached house in Battle (TN33 0DJ). It has a recorded floor area of 42 m² (around 452 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band A. At 42 m² this is the smallest unit on EPC record across the building (42–102 m²). The building's EPC ratings span E to C, with this unit at the top. The latest certificate (January 2013) shows a C (score 74). When first surveyed in January 2009 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ency went from Very Poor to Good, lighting went from Very Poor to Good and main heating went from Poor to Good. The latest certificate is from January 2013,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
